In the healthcare setting, gathering various records is a continuous process. Medical records, vital sign records, progress notes, prescription records, imaging test results, lab test results, and consultation reports are a few of them. These records are necessary for both managing patient data and creating a medical care plan that works for the patient. Using EMR and EHR software is a practical way to retain and retrieve patient data optimally and accurately. This decreases the danger that comes with manually entering patient data. The centralization of patient data is one way that custom EMR & EHR software aids in effective patient data management in healthcare settings. The software uses a variety of mechanisms to make this possible. These encompass role-based access control, audit trails, version controls, patient identification and matching, data standardization and normalization, cross-referencing, and linking. The integration of data sources into a single electronic record is also included.
They are all essential to the centralization of patient data. Comprehensive patient profiles, better care coordination, increased patient safety, effective workflow and documentation, real-time data access, efficient data analysis and reporting, and patient empowerment are all encouraged by centralized patient data. These all guarantee efficient patient data management.
